Abstract
To understand functions of our brain by simulating a neuronal circuit, we require mathematical models of neurons and synapses. Many models of neurons have been proposed, but modeling of synapses, especially modeling of synaptic plasticity seems not to be well established. In the present study, we propose a biophysical model of a form of synaptic plasticity (spike-timing-dependent plasticity, STDP), and discuss the effectiveness of biophysical modeling in synaptic plasticity.
